Concrete driveway installation involves preparing the site, pouring, and finishing a durable concrete surface that serves as the primary pathway for vehicles and foot traffic. The process typically starts with excavating the existing surface, ensuring proper grading and drainage to prevent water pooling or damage over time. Once the foundation is prepared, a concrete mix is poured into formwork, then smoothed and finished to achieve a clean, level surface. Some projects may incorporate reinforcement materials like steel rebar or wire mesh to enhance strength and longevity, especially for larger driveways or areas with heavy vehicle use.
This service helps address common problems such as cracking, uneven surfaces, and deterioration caused by weather, frequent use, or poor initial installation. A properly installed concrete driveway provides a stable, low-maintenance surface that resists shifting and settling, reducing the risk of trip hazards or costly repairs down the line. The overview below groups typical Concrete Driveway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Poolesville,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or driveway repairs or patching range from $250-$600, depending on the extent of the work and materials used.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end for more extensive repairs.
Standard Driveway Installation - Installing a new concrete driveway usually costs between $3,000 and $7,000 for most homeowners in the area. Larger or more complex projects can exceed this range, especially with custom finishes or added features.
Full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of an existing driveway often falls between $4,500 and $10,000, with costs increasing for larger areas or intricate designs. Many projects in this category are priced in the middle to upper tiers based on size and complexity.
Custom or Decorative Finishes - Specialty finishes like stamped or stained concrete can add $2,000 to $5,000 or more to the overall cost. These are less common and tend to push the project into the higher cost brackets, depending on the detail and materials chosen.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ing a concrete driveway? Concrete driveways are durable, low maintenance, and can enhance the curb appeal of a property in Poolesville, MD and nearby areas.
How do local contractors prepare the area for concrete driveway installation? They typically clear the site, ensure proper grading, and set a stable base to support the concrete and prevent future issues.
What types of finishes are available for concrete driveways? Options include stamped, stained, brushed, or plain concrete finishes to match different aesthetic preferences.
Are there different styles or patterns for concrete driveway designs? Yes, contractors can incorporate various patterns, borders, and textures to customize the driveway's appearance.
What factors influence the longevity of a concrete driveway? Proper installation, quality materials, and regular maintenance help ensure a concrete driveway lasts for many years.
